Output af12e889e6660eeafe39b30108985e6488601ff5b940235aff879e6069063a22:44

value
1444111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0e2a1f9b683cb5934bfc4d2b5615b39ae22bd64 OP_EQUAL
address
3KGuA6K5zwA94X6fusrARPNd1AbXyp6E9t
transaction
af12e889e6660eeafe39b30108985e6488601ff5b940235aff879e6069063a22
spent
true